Decatur Police Department, Illinois
End of Watch Monday, October 3, 2005
Add to My HeroesRobin G. Vogel
Police Officer Robin Vogel succumbed to injuries suffered two days earlier in an automobile crash at the intersection of E Pershing Road and N Main Street.
Officer Vogel was on patrol when her squad car was broadsided by a drunk driver of a vehicle that ran a red light at a high rate of speed at 4:00 am.
The driver had a blood-alcohol content over twice the legal limit and was killed instantly. Officer Vogel was transported to a local hospital and then transferred to a trauma center where she died two days later.
Officer Vogel had served with the Decatur Police Department for seven years. She is survived by her son, parents, and two sisters.
Bio
- Age 37
- Tour 7 years
- Badge 247
Incident Details
- Cause Vehicular assault
- Incident Date Saturday, October 1, 2005
- Weapon Automobile; Alcohol involved
- Offender Killed in crash
Most Recent Reflection
View all 403 ReflectionsCondolences to her family and her friends
Carson loveless
March 26, 2024
Recent LODD Deaths

Deputy Sergeant Martin Shields, Jr.
Hinds County Sheriff's Office, MS
EOW: February 23, 2025

Police Officer Christopher M. L. Reese
Virginia Beach Police Department, VA
EOW: February 22, 2025

Police Officer Cameron Robert Girvin
Virginia Beach Police Department, VA
EOW: February 22, 2025

Patrolman Andrew William Duarte
West York Borough Police Department, PA
EOW: February 22, 2025

Trooper Kyle McAcy
Nebraska State Patrol, NE
EOW: February 17, 2025

Police Officer Jeremy R. Labonte
Roswell Police Department, GA
EOW: February 7, 2025

Officer Jason Roscow
North Las Vegas Police Department, NV
EOW: February 4, 2025

Chief Deputy Burl Wesley Everman
Bath County Sheriff's Office, KY
EOW: November 9, 2024

Police Officer Philip J. Schifini
Nassau County Police Department, NY
EOW: November 27, 2024